Output 61d762b0414467e9f60ac1d93c52c6f3d4d7040958874630ece54cc6f1359278:6

value
35398230
script pubkey
OP_0 OP_PUSHBYTES_20 f3c05ab727db3315d3bcef366d2a814ae5e69e8e
address
ltc1q70q94de8mve3t5auaumx625pftj7d85w078lz8
transaction
61d762b0414467e9f60ac1d93c52c6f3d4d7040958874630ece54cc6f1359278
spent
true